It sounds like you have one the the Effects setting ON.

Right click on the Microsoft Speaker icon in the system trar.

Select Playback devices.

Select Speakers.
Select select the "properties" button. (lower right)

Look at all of the options you have.
Select the Enhancements tab.

At the bottom set "simulates multiple playback environments" to NONE.

Above that you have Equalizer, adjust for more volume/tone.
